Stone the scarecrows - Our town has gone mad!
if your mind’s boggling for a tattieboggle this weekend then Bothwell is the place to be.
The South Lanarkshire town is overrun by hundreds of scarecrows for the first ever Bothwell Scarecrow Festival.
Residents and businesses have got behind the festival in a big way, with an incredible array of scarecrows popping up all around the town.
Organiser Harry Marsh got the idea for the festival when he saw a similar event in England. He said “My wife Joan and I were on holiday in Lancashire when we came across the Charnock Richard Scarecrow Festival. We decided to do something similar at home here in Bothwell and the main aim is to bring the community together.”
The three day Festival comes to a close with the Scarecrow Parade through the town on Sunday afternoon.
